Minecraft shouldn't be an RPG game. But, it should be fully able to be made into one. While certainly there are design issues with RPG games, economy issues, and spell/skill issues, and elements of good and bad design. Those are design issues, they are not Minecraft issues.
Generally there are some elements of Minecraft that would lend themselves to MUD (smaller typically text based games of old) namely the block system, the physics system, and loading from the server, and out of the box functionality. There are other issues that don't lend themselves well, like the changing the world aspect. Any reasonable RPG would generally not allow players to modify the world. What's the point of building a large city if various people can blow up the shops? But, those are game choices.
The relevancy to Minecraft is not to build an RPG, or even the framework for an RPG, but rather to build the ability to modify it such that it could be made into that. If I wanted to, at the server level, rip out most of the game and replace it with an extremely complex and elegant RPG could I do that? What is stopping it from working? Not the whining about potential terrible design, assume I'm really a fantastic programmer and designer, what is missing that prevents that from happening. -- Whatever is missing for such a large modification is also missing for any other large modifications (so it's not really specifically RPG based). Could I implement Pac-Man? Could I make a board where I run around picking up dots being chased by ghasts in a pretty specific pattern? I'm not saying I would ever care about that, or ever want to play such a silly game. But, I'd like it to be totally possible.
Having Minecraft add dozens of silly weapons is a waste. But, why couldn't the server modification add such items and have it reflected for the client. Can a server modification give people an aura? Can a server modification give a secondary stat like HP (Mana)? Can a server modification make radically different mobs exist? The point of a sandbox game is to allow for anything, and frankly anybody with a lot of time, should be able to nestle a very functional RPG into that if it's built right. Right now a good amount of that functionality doesn't exist. What would be needed, to make it possible to make a really good framework for an RPG or other radically modified implementation.
Many of the ideas bantered about are well beyond the scope of Minecraft, but they should be within the scope of the Minecraft engine, and yeah, people can make crap. But, some people can make rather fantastic worlds if given half a chance.
If your best idea for a game is prevented me from being able to cut down a birch tree until I have enough experience with normal trees and then a lot of birch trees until I can successfully chop down a pine tree, that's just you being lame. If you want to give players, having reached sufficient level, the ability to cast invisibility and vanish briefly, that's awesome. Yeah, people can make crap but they can also make awesome. And the whole point of a sandbox is to just make it feasible. Nobody should request an RPG game, but they should request the tools needed to make a good one.
With current mods/plugins in play I can easily see a semi-RPG in place.
By adding a Regional Guard (aka, changes cannot be made, no addding/removing blocks) in a "city area" the city can be preserved, for "city purposes" such as Trade/advertising/adventure, etc. Nothing like getting to the old pub and having a few drinks while talking about what you found in a mine that day.
This means that while keeping the city preserved for everyone to enjoy - it allows the normal flow of game outside of town, blowing stuff up, building up huge skyscrapers, etc.
As for most of the rest, sure skills are pointless, WRONG. How about a EXP/leveling system based on what your doing? If your farming, it levels up Farming, if your Chopping wood, it levels up Lumberjacking, if your fighting mobs, it levels up, you guessed it, Combat. What does this do? you may ask, well simply put, it should give you the only thing you need... more stuff. Let's say level 100 is the cap, at level 100 you have say a 30% chance that whatever your doing (farming, mining, lumberjacking, combat) when the job is 'done' (aka, block destroyed, mob killed, crops harvested, wood cut) gives you double resources, instead of the 1/few. So you could get 2 blocks of wood, or a skeleton could drop 4 bones, etc.
Wouldn't that be useful? More resources for less work, simply because you put the effort in, means more fun doing other things besides "collection".
Sure Intelligence, Charisma and all that are pointless, and I totally agree they would just muck up the server, especially if "stamina" or "mana" or whatever you wanna call it were added. No need for it.
Levels, by themselves "I am a level 43 player now!" Are not really needed but, "dude My mining just hit 72!" would be something to shoot for, as a goal, instead of just.. break block... break block... while collecting materials for whatever project your doing at the time.
